CVE-2021-20262: Missing Authentication for Critical Function

March 9, 2021 (updated March 15, 2021)

A flaw was found in Keycloak where re-authentication does not occur while updating the password. This flaw allows an attacker to take over an account if they can obtain temporary, physical access to a user’s browser. The highest threat from this vulnerability is to confidentiality, integrity, as well as system availability.

Affected versions

Version 12.0.0

Fixed versions

  • 12.0.1

Solution

Upgrade to version 12.0.1 or above.

Impact 6.8 MEDIUM

CVSS:3.1/AV:P/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H
